    Hi:

    I just finished doing a quilt with black and white fabric and it is a lot of fun I used a pattern I have made another one also using different coordinating colors for each square. I used the pattern called stitched scrappy quilt and then i did the piano keys for the border since it was all black and white. It turned out real nice. If you want to pm me you e-mail address I will send you a picture of it. I had to keep looking also for fabric but I just kept plugging along. I found a lot at Joanns and Hancocks .

    Good Luck and keep quilting.
